How long do migraine headaches typically last?

Explanation:
Migraine headaches are characterized by their specific duration and symptoms. The typical duration of a migraine attack is indeed between 4 to 72 hours. This timeframe is supported by clinical definitions of migraines found in resources such as the International Classification of Headache Disorders. During this period, individuals may experience a variety of symptoms including severe unilateral head pain, nausea, and sensitivity to light or sound. Understanding this duration is crucial for diagnosing migraines properly and differentiating them from other types of headaches, like tension-type headaches, which may have different characteristics regarding their duration and intensity. This knowledge is essential in both treatment planning and patient education. Additionally, recognizing the typical time span of migraines can help in identifying triggers and managing headaches more effectively.
